How Many Bytes in a Megabyte?
Resposta Rápida
There are 1,048,576 bytes in a megabyte (binary) or 1,000,000 bytes (decimal).
1 MB (binary) = 2²⁰ = 1,048,576 bytes
Entendendo a Conversão
In computing, 1 megabyte (MB) = 2²⁰ = 1,048,576 bytes (binary/IEC definition). Hard drive manufacturers use the decimal definition (1 MB = 1,000,000 bytes), which is why a drive's labeled capacity appears smaller than reported by an OS.

Exemplos Comuns
| Descrição | Valor |
|---|---|
| A 1 MB text file | ≈1,000 pages of plain text |
| A high-quality JPEG photo | 1–5 MB |
| 1 minute of MP3 audio (128 kbps) | ≈1 MB |
